What is LifeStar Holding Revenue?

LifeStar Holding MAL:LSR 18 Revenue is €10.69 Mil as of Dec. 2025. GuruFocus rates MAL:LSR with a GF Score™ of 18/100. The stock has 2 warning signs investors should review.

LifeStar Holding's revenue for the six months ended in Dec. 2025 was €6.54 Mil. Its revenue for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 was €10.69 Mil. LifeStar Holding's Revenue per Share for the six months ended in Dec. 2025 was €0.27. Its Revenue per Share for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 was €0.44.

LifeStar Holding  (MAL:LSR) Revenue Explanation

In ranking the predictability, companies with more consistent revenue and earnings growth are ranked high with predictability.

Peter Lynch categorized companies according to their revenue growth:


Slow Grower: Inflation < 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ate < 10%:
Stalwart: 10% < 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ate < 20%:
Fast Grower: 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ate > 20%:

His favorite companies are stalwart, those growing between 10-20% a year.

Companies in cyclical industries may see their revenue fluctuate wildly in good years and bad years.


Be Aware

Revenue can be manipulated by changing the way how revenue is booked. Companies may book sales before the payment is received, or before the revenue is fully earned. These will be added to balance sheet items such as account payable or account receivables.

LifeStar Holding Business Description

Address Testaferrata Street, Ta Xbiex, MLT, XBX 1403
LifeStar Holding PLC is a financial services company registered in Malta. The company operates in four segments namely Investment and advisory services, Business of insurance, Agency and brokerage Services, and Property Services. Geographically, the company operates in Malta.
